当前位置: 首页 > news >正文

Chapter 6 Frequency Response of Amplifiers

Chapter 6 Frequency Response of Amplifiers

这一节我们学习单极和差分运放的频率响应.

6.1 General Considerations

我们关心magnitude vs 频率, 因此有低通, 带通, 高通滤波器

6.1.1 Miller Effect

Miller’s Theorem

考虑impedance Z1和Z2, X和Y之间增益为Av.

Z1 = Z/(1-Av). Z2 = Z/(1-Av^-1). Av=Vy/Vx.

原理证明:

利用miller原理, 可以在X端产生Cf*Av的大电容(miller电容)

6.1.2 Association of Poles with Nodes

对于下图级联的运放, 我们可以写出传输函数

传输函数

6.2 Common-Source Stage

考虑下图的CS结构

在X处有Cgd的miller cap=Ccd*(gm Rd), 估算输入端极点为

估算输出端极点为

但这里的估算没有体出零点, 我们采用Direct Analysis

可得传输函数

采用极点分离, 主极点为

对比直接求解(6.35)和我们用miller cap (6.21)得估算, 两者差距不大

当Cgs dominates时, 次极点和估算一样.

6-30公式直接分析展示了有一个右零点. wz=+gm/Cgd. 右零点代表两条通路的极性相反, 因此输出可能为零!

右零点意味着在w=wz时输出Vout=0, 输出shorted to grond. 说明所有电流都通过Cgd走到了沟道, 没有电流流过RD. 通过Cgd的电流为v * admittance. admittance=Cgs*wz.

右零点位置可得
ω z = + g m C G D \omega_{z}=+\frac{g_{m}}{C_{GD}} ωz=+CGDgm

考虑输入阻抗, 采用miller效益简化为, 即Cgs+miller电容

6.3 Source Followers

source follower 作为level shifters或者buffers, 也会影响整体的频率响应. 考虑下图

可推导出传输函数

如果输出电容CL=0, Vout/Vin可简化为

Cgd引入了极点. Cgs电容, 由于source follower的效果Gate short to Source, 因此不引入零点和极点.

考虑输入阻抗

考虑输出阻抗

SF的Zout的输出阻抗大部分表现为从©, 即有电感属性, 即impedance随着频率增加而增加

6.4 Common-Gate Stage

考虑下图common-gate结构

其输入输出传输函数为

没有miller电容效应, CG结构主要应用于:1) 需要小的输入阻抗. 2) 在cascode stage中.

输入阻抗:

6.5 Cascode Stage

考虑cascode结构如下图所示

miller效应的Cgd1在A和X之间, 但是gain很小, X向M2看进去的阻抗为1/gm2.

A处极点:

X处极点:

Y处极点:

一般来说X处的极点为高频极点, 因为阻抗低1/gm.

输出阻抗:

Zx=ro1||(CX s)^−1

6.6 Differential Pair

6.6.1 Differential Pair with Passive Loads

考虑差分结构带电阻, 如下图所示

CM增益为

CMRR为

在高频下, M3 source的CP会降低P点阻抗, 降低CMRR. CMRR分布图如下

如果输出端是MOS,那么高频极点为Vout处的Cgd*Rout

6.6.2 Differential Pair with Active Load

带active current mirror的差分对如下所示, 考虑输出输入函数

主极点在输出Vout处, wp1=1/(Rout*CL)

次极点在E处, 即mirror pole, wp2=1/(gm3*Ce)

另外还有一个左零点. 位置在次极点的两倍频处. 来源于M1-M3-M4为slow path, M1和M2为fast path, 两者极性相同, 因此为左零点. (极性相反为右零点, 例如带miller电容的CS结构)
ω z = 2 g m p C E \omega_{z}=\frac{2g_{mp}}{C_{E}} ωz=CE2gmp
输入输出传函为:

6.7 Gain-Bandwidth Trade-Offs

我们考虑w-3db和unity-gain带宽 wu.

6.7.1 One-Pole Circuits

对于上图的单极点系统

“gain-bandwidth” product=GBW=Gain*dominant pole

对于单极点系统 GBW=wu, 即unity-gain bandwith

注意套筒式cascoding并不能提高GBW, cascode只能提高gain, 相应的f-3db会减少, 维持GBW不变.

6.7.2 Multi-Pole Circuits

通过级联cascading 两级或者三级增益级, 是可以提高GBW的. 如下图所示

输入输出传函为

为了得到f-3db. Vout/VIn=A0^2/sqrt(2)

f-3db减小了

但是GBW增大了64%

所以级联cascading 能增加系统的GBW, 但缺点是功耗加倍, 另外容易造成系统的不稳定.

相关文章:

  • 代码随想录算法训练营第五十四 | ● 392.判断子序列 ● 115.不同的子序列
  • SpringBoot引入WebSocket依赖报ServerContainer no avaliable
  • centos官方yum源不可用 解决方案(随手记)
  • OBS 录屏软件:录制圆形头像画中画,设置卡通人像(保姆级教程,有步骤图,建议收藏)
  • 首届IEEE RAS峰会,为什么大厂阿里、字节、腾讯都参加了?
  • 让GNSSRTK不再难【第一天】
  • **《Linux/Unix系统编程手册》读书笔记24章**
  • L2-002 链表去重(C++)
  • PyTorch tutorials:快速学会使用PyTorch
  • 从0开始学人工智能测试节选:Spark -- 结构化数据领域中测试人员的万金油技术(四)
  • Jmeter —— jmeter设置HTTP信息头管理器模拟请求头
  • Python 连接 MySQL 及 SQL增删改查(主要使用sqlalchemy)
  • 基于百度翻译API的火车头PHP翻译插件,可以翻译HTML片段
  • mybatis-plus 多租户方案1使用和坑注意事项,方案是需要实现租户功能的表都增加租户id字段
  • 【Linux多线程】线程的终止、等待和分离
  • 《剑指offer》分解让复杂问题更简单
  • Java 多线程编程之:notify 和 wait 用法
  • Laravel Telescope:优雅的应用调试工具
  • Magento 1.x 中文订单打印乱码
  • python 装饰器(一)
  • ReactNativeweexDeviceOne对比
  • WinRAR存在严重的安全漏洞影响5亿用户
  • 搭建gitbook 和 访问权限认证
  • 道格拉斯-普克 抽稀算法 附javascript实现
  • 湖南卫视:中国白领因网络偷菜成当代最寂寞的人?
  • 类orAPI - 收藏集 - 掘金
  • 力扣(LeetCode)56
  • 前端每日实战 2018 年 7 月份项目汇总(共 29 个项目)
  • 前端每日实战:70# 视频演示如何用纯 CSS 创作一只徘徊的果冻怪兽
  • 删除表内多余的重复数据
  • 什么软件可以提取视频中的音频制作成手机铃声
  • 学习ES6 变量的解构赋值
  • 学习HTTP相关知识笔记
  • 一些关于Rust在2019年的思考
  • 怎样选择前端框架
  • 找一份好的前端工作,起点很重要
  • 蚂蚁金服CTO程立:真正的技术革命才刚刚开始
  • 直播平台建设千万不要忘记流媒体服务器的存在 ...
  • #大学#套接字
  • #绘制圆心_R语言——绘制一个诚意满满的圆 祝你2021圆圆满满
  • #我与Java虚拟机的故事#连载04:一本让自己没面子的书
  • $jQuery 重写Alert样式方法
  • (03)光刻——半导体电路的绘制
  • (4)通过调用hadoop的java api实现本地文件上传到hadoop文件系统上
  • (C语言)二分查找 超详细
  • (NO.00004)iOS实现打砖块游戏(十二):伸缩自如,我是如意金箍棒(上)!
  • (WSI分类)WSI分类文献小综述 2024
  • (附源码)ssm高校实验室 毕业设计 800008
  • (牛客腾讯思维编程题)编码编码分组打印下标题目分析
  • (四)汇编语言——简单程序
  • (学习日记)2024.04.04:UCOSIII第三十二节:计数信号量实验
  • (已更新)关于Visual Studio 2019安装时VS installer无法下载文件,进度条为0,显示网络有问题的解决办法
  • (转载)OpenStack Hacker养成指南
  • **PHP二维数组遍历时同时赋值
  • .CSS-hover 的解释